Camping near Brunswick
Within reach of Brunswick, 4 campgrounds across 1 park appear on Recreation.gov: 4 at Acadia.
Recreation.gov releases most national park campsites six months before the arrival date, at 10:00 a.m. Eastern time. Windows are set per campground, so confirm yours on the Seasons and Fees tab on that campground page.
Once a date is gone, cancellations are the real supply, and they get taken within minutes of appearing.
When to make this trip
Acadia National Park is generally best May through October, with April and early November as the quieter shoulder either side.
Winter brings cold, shorter days, and reduced services, though lower-elevation trails often stay walkable.
Peak summer weekends and autumn colour weekends fill parking lots early — arrive before mid-morning.

Planning a trip from Brunswick
Distances here are straight-line and the drive estimate adds a road factor on top, but mountain passes and seasonal closures can change it a lot — a route that looks like three hours in June can be shut entirely in February. Confirm road status with the park before you commit to a date.
